Program Analysis

At $48,724/yr, Mathematics graduates from Millersville University of Pennsylvania land near the $50,797 national average — neither a standout nor a red flag.

With a 10.7x return on in-state tuition over ten years, the financial case for this program is compelling by virtually any measure.

The 8% difference between AI scenarios reflects partial automation exposure. Some Mathematics career paths face displacement, but others in the field are more insulated.

The median debt load of $24,059 represents less than half a year of starting salary — among the lightest debt-to-income ratios we track.

A #159 ranking among 253 Mathematics programs places Millersville University of Pennsylvania in the lower half. Price, proximity, and personal fit become the stronger arguments.

The limited growth from $48,724 to $53,549 over five years suggests earnings in this field plateau relatively early in one's career.
